 Tl - the contact owns a 2006 ford f-150. the contact stated that while having maintenance done on the vehicle, he was notified that both of the coil springs broke due to corrosion. the manufacturer was not made aware of the failure. the vehicle was not repaired. the failure and current mileage was 95,000. pm

 I discovered a leaky rear shock absorber on my 2006 ford truck while still under warranty. i took it to my dealer who confirmed that the shock absorber was defective and would replace it, but not the pair. every professional shop that i have spoken with, to include the ford dealer, says shock absorbers should always be replaced in pairs, but ford refuses to replace the pair--it says it will only replace the defective one. i appealed to ford motor corp and they too refused. i believe that is wrong and unsafe. *tr
